Monday, July 19, 2010

We traveled pretty fare today 423 miles in the motor home across Indiana and into Illinois. Gained an hour of time while heading west, you got to love that.  I drove for like 5 hours; it was tough going because I was the one driving around Chicago on a six lane highway heading west.  Stopped for some Starbucks and I was good to good for a million more miles.  So after the Starbucks, I was still driving and really had to use the restroom.  We were at a toll plaza waiting in line to pay, because Sarge forgot the ezpass, I jumped out of the driver's seat and told Ally I will be right back.  So I went to the back of the RV to use the restroom.  Ally and Barb were mortified, but no worries I was back and in the driver’s seat before the toll line moved an inch.  The hold up was a mini van trying to figure out how to pay.  I wish people would just read directions and buy maps. 

We stopped around 5pm at the Hickory Hollow Campground in Utica, Illinois.  It was kind of weird all the town names we saw were the same names as in New York, even an Oswego Illinois. 

After getting to the camp ground Rory and I went swimming in a heated pool and of course went to the playground before dinner.  She is having so much fun.  She seems to be playing all morning with her toys and after lunch knapping in the afternoons while we are on the road.  After dinner Barb, Sarge and Ally went off to WalMart.  They definitely got some necessities, like the fixings for smores and an IPod auxiliary adapter cord for the sterio.  Rory, Ally and I made some smores….Sarge tried to grill his and burnt the gram crackers and melted the chocolate all over the grill.  So if our chicken tastes like chocolate tonight we may know why.  I think Ally will try driving the family truckster  as she calls it, aka the motor home tomorrow.
